通过PROFINET实现S7-300/400与SINAMICS S120通讯指南

需积分: 9 0 下载量 181 浏览量 更新于2024-07-17 收藏 654KB PDF 举报
本文档是关于通过PROFINET通信协议实现西门子S7-300 PLC与SINAMICS S120驱动器之间的交互的指南,涵盖了硬件配置、编程方法以及故障排查等内容。 文章详细介绍了如何利用PROFINET IO/Real-Time (RT) 功能在CPU319-3PN/DP与SINAMICS S120之间建立高效的数据通信。PROFINET是一种基于工业以太网的通信标准,它允许周期性和非周期性的数据交换。S7-300/400系列PLC使用SFC14/SFC15功能块向驱动器发送控制命令和主设定值,而SFB52/SFB53则用于非周期性地读取或写入驱动器参数。 硬件连接部分描述了SIMATIC CPU319-3PN/DP与S120驱动控制器CU310PN之间的物理连接方式,强调了所需硬件组件和软件版本,包括STEP7 V5.4 SP2 HF3编程软件,SCOUT V4.1 SP1、STARTER V4.1 SP1用于驱动器配置和调试,以及S120驱动软件V2.5 SP1 HF1。 项目配置环节涉及配置PROFINET网络,设置S7-300/400的接口,以及在SINAMICS驱动器中配置相应的网络参数。这一步确保了PLC和驱动器能够识别彼此并成功建立通信。 调试阶段,用户可以使用STARTER和SCOUT工具进行在线诊断和参数调整。STARTER用于测试和调试SINAMICS驱动器,而SCOUT用于配置和监控整个自动化系统。 实际操作部分详述了通过PN总线控制电机的启动、停止和速度调节,以及读取和写入驱动器参数的具体步骤。这些操作通常涉及编写和执行特定的PLC程序段。 最后,提供了程序参考实例,帮助读者理解并实现类似的通信任务。这些实例可能包括控制字和设定值的传递,以及参数读写的示例代码。 这份文档为工程师提供了完整的指南,使他们能够有效地利用PROFINET在S7-300 PLC和SINAMICS S120驱动之间建立通信,实现自动化系统的高效运行和精确控制。